Paver Driveway Construction in Saint George, UT
Paver driveway construction involves installing durable, visually appealing driveways using interlocking pavers made from materials such as concrete, brick, or stone. These projects typically include preparing the existing ground, laying a stable base, and carefully placing the pavers to create a smooth, level surface. Homeowners often choose paver driveways for their aesthetic appeal, long-lasting quality, and ability to enhance the overall look of a property.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ider factors like the size and layout of the driveway, preferred materials, and any specific design features or patterns they want to incorporate.
Understanding the scope of paver driveway construction is essential for property owners planning such a project. They usually want clarity on the durability of different materials, the maintenance involved, and how the driveway will complement the property's existing landscape. It’s also helpful to consider drainage solutions and how the driveway will handle local weather conditions. Clarifying these details can assist in choosing the right design and material options, ensuring the finished driveway meets both functional needs and aesthetic preferences.

Paver Driveway Construction Questions
What types of pavers are suitable for driveways? Conc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ers are common choices for durable driveway surfaces in Saint George, UT.
How thick should pavers be for a driveway? Pavers for driveways typically range from 2 to 3 inches in thickness to withstand vehicle weight.
What is involved in preparing a driveway for paver installation? Proper site grading, a stable base layer, and a solid foundation are essential for a long-lasting paver driveway.
Can paver driveways be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, in some cases, pavers can be installed over existing concrete or asphalt with proper preparation.
